Pune: A 7-day Itinerary for June 2023

  1. Day 1: Shaniwar Wada
    20 minutes (6.5 km) from Pune Airport

    Visit the historic fort and palace of the Peshwas in the morning. Explore the intricate architecture and learn about the rich history of the Maratha Empire. In the afternoon, head to the nearby Dagdusheth Halwai Ganpati Temple, one of the most famous temples in Pune. End the day with a stroll through the lively and vibrant markets of Tulshi Baug.

  2. Day 2: Aga Khan Palace
    30 minutes (8.5 km) from Shaniwar Wada

    Start the day with a serene visit to the Aga Khan Palace, a monument of national importance. Explore the sprawling garden and learn about the palace's role in India's struggle for independence. In the afternoon, head to the nearby Osho Ashram and indulge in some meditation and relaxation. End the day with a visit to the nearby Koregaon Park, known for its trendy restaurants and cafes.

  3. Day 3: Sinhagad Fort
    1 hour 20 minutes (35.7 km) from Aga Khan Palace

    Embark on a scenic drive to Sinhagad Fort, located on a hilltop overlooking the city. Experience the breathtaking views of the surrounding valleys and hills. In the afternoon, visit the nearby Khadakwasla Dam and enjoy a refreshing boat ride. End the day with a visit to the famous Raja Dinkar Kelkar Museum, showcasing the art and artifacts of India.

  4. Day 4: Pataleshwar Cave Temple
    30 minutes (5.6 km) from Raja Dinkar Kelkar Museum

    Start the day by exploring the ancient rock-cut Pataleshwar Cave Temple, dedicated to Lord Shiva. In the afternoon, head to the nearby Bund Garden and take a relaxing boat ride. End the day with a visit to the nearby Darshan Museum, showcasing the life and work of Sadhu Vaswani.

  5. Day 5: Parvati Hill
    20 minutes (6.5 km) from Darshan Museum

    Embark on a scenic drive to Parvati Hill, one of the highest points in Pune. Visit the famous temples of Parvati and Devdeveshwar, and enjoy the panoramic views of the city. In the afternoon, head to the nearby Saras Baug and enjoy a leisurely walk in the lush gardens. End the day with a visit to the nearby Chaturshringi Temple, dedicated to Goddess Chaturshringi.

  6. Day 6: Shinde Chhatri
    30 minutes (9.4 km) from Chaturshringi Temple

    Start the day by visiting the historic Shinde Chhatri, a memorial dedicated to the Maratha nobleman Mahadji Shinde. Explore the beautiful architecture and learn about the rich history of the Maratha Empire. In the afternoon, head to the nearby Raja Kelkar Museum and admire the impressive collection of Indian art and artifacts. End the day with a visit to the nearby Joshi's Museum of Miniature Railways.

  7. Day 7: National Defence Academy
    40 minutes (17.8 km) from Joshi's Museum of Miniature Railways

    Embark on a scenic drive to the National Defence Academy, a premier military training institution in India. Explore the sprawling campus and learn about the life and training of Indian cadets. In the afternoon, head to the nearby Pashan Lake and enjoy a peaceful walk in the lush surroundings. End the day with a visit to the nearby Vetal Tekdi, known for its serene nature trails.

Recommendations

If you have extra time, consider visiting the nearby hill stations of Lonavala and Khandala. You can also take a day trip to the historic city of Aurangabad and visit the famous Ajanta and Ellora caves. Don't forget to try the famous Maharashtrian cuisine, including vada pav, misal pav, and bhakri. Lastly, to make the most of your trip, consider hiring a local guide to help you navigate the city and learn more about its rich history and culture.
